Withdrawn in the UK because it cost the government too much in prescription fees but it was the pain med that worked for me. Now I'm prescribed codeine phosphate 30's and I probably take 60mg 5 or 6 times a day depending on how bad the pain is .

Not sure what it co-prox was called outside the uk but does anyone have any suggestions for a replacement -I know it was a synthetic compound but that's all the info I have.

Thanks

 
I believe it is what was Darvocet in the US. It is no longer FDA approved here.

co-proxamol was withdrawn because there is a high risk of poisoning, more so than codeine and other mild opiates. It is still available in the UK as a named patient special product, but it would be near impossible to get your GP to prescribe it. AMC have it, expensive though.
